离子 2/3- 标签定位
ionic 2/3- tabs positioning
我正在使用 Ionic 2 开发 Ionic 应用程序。
我在几个页面中实现了选项卡。但是在一个页面中,选项卡需要放在底部,而在另一个页面上,它需要放在顶部。这两个页面中的选项卡不同。
例如,在页面 A 上,标签需要放在底部,而在页面 B 上,标签需要放在顶部
在app.module.ts
中,我给出了如下代码
IonicModule.forRoot(MyApp, {
tabsPlacement: 'top',
platforms: {
android: {
tabsPlacement: 'top'
},
ios: {
tabsPlacement: 'top'
},
windows:
{
tabsPlacement: 'top'
}
}
}),
以上代码,将两个页面上的选项卡都放在顶部。
我的问题是,有没有一种方法可以指定页面特定的标签位置?
谢谢!
如果要在两个不同的页面上使用两个不同的选项卡,您可以简单地使用组件上的 tabsPlacement 属性将选项卡放置在页面的顶部或底部。从您的配置中删除选项卡位置并在各个选项卡上添加 tabsPlacement 属性 html
<ion-tabs tabsPlacement="top"> // specify bottom to position at the bottom
...
<ion-tabs>
我正在使用 Ionic 2 开发 Ionic 应用程序。 我在几个页面中实现了选项卡。但是在一个页面中,选项卡需要放在底部,而在另一个页面上,它需要放在顶部。这两个页面中的选项卡不同。
例如,在页面 A 上,标签需要放在底部,而在页面 B 上,标签需要放在顶部
在app.module.ts
中,我给出了如下代码
IonicModule.forRoot(MyApp, {
tabsPlacement: 'top',
platforms: {
android: {
tabsPlacement: 'top'
},
ios: {
tabsPlacement: 'top'
},
windows:
{
tabsPlacement: 'top'
}
}
}),
以上代码,将两个页面上的选项卡都放在顶部。
我的问题是,有没有一种方法可以指定页面特定的标签位置?
谢谢!
如果要在两个不同的页面上使用两个不同的选项卡,您可以简单地使用组件上的 tabsPlacement 属性将选项卡放置在页面的顶部或底部。从您的配置中删除选项卡位置并在各个选项卡上添加 tabsPlacement 属性 html
<ion-tabs tabsPlacement="top"> // specify bottom to position at the bottom
...
<ion-tabs>